Practical Brand Designer Notes for Implementation
Before integrating Merry Christmas SVG DXF 7 Layers into your paid campaigns or client work, follow these practical steps to ensure professional results:
- Color Palette Testing: Test the design with your brand colors. Since it is a layered file, try separating the layers to apply different hues, creating a gradient effect that matches your product label or logo design.
- Black and White Check: Preview the asset in grayscale. This helps identify any areas where contrast might be lost, ensuring visibility across all mediums.
- Font Pairing: Experiment with typography. The ornate nature of the mandala pairs well with elegant serif fonts for headlines, while sans-serif fonts work best for body text. Avoid script or handwritten fonts unless they are very clean, as they may clash with the geometric precision of the layers.
- Mobile Readability: Always preview your designs on mobile screens. Ensure that the central area remains open enough for text overlays to be legible on smaller devices.
- Licensing Confirmation: Confirm the commercial license before using this asset in any revenue-generating activities. While many platforms allow resale of physical items made from the files, digital redistribution rights vary.
